Highway patrol to crack down on seat belts

RALEIGH, N.C. (AP) — State troopers will be watching drivers who aren't wearing seat belts for the next two weeks.

The Highway Patrol is conducting Operation Buckle-Up 2007 starting today. The statewide enforcement drive ends September 23rd.

Statewide seat belt use is 89 percent and the goal is to raise it to more than 90 percent in an effort to cut highway fatalities.
